ABOUT ME

I have to confess I am addicted to archery. My love for the sport began 20 years ago when some local archery club members walked into a park meeting I was attending and introduced us to the sport of archery. I couldn't resist the invitation to come to the club and learn about it. It was love at first shot and it still is today. 

​

I have supported the NASP (National Archery in the School Program) for more than nine years as a line official and in helping set up their ranges for regional, state and world tournaments. I co-coached with a local elementary school for four years and am now serving local schools who would like assistance in getting their archery programs going.

I love teaching archery!

​

I compete in local, regional and national tournaments. I currently hold the South Carolina SCAA state record 2018 in the Vegas round for Master Senior Women. I have won at The Vegas Shoot in NFAA archery and also have some top wins with ASA in 3D archery.

I currently shoot a Hoyt Hyper Edge and also a Hoyt Defiant for 3D archery. I am learning recurve archery and have a Hoyt Horizon recurve.

Be Brave Be a Wild Child

I started saying this phrase a few years ago. I had a young child came to me for lessons and he was afraid. He hid behind his mom and said, " I don't want to be here." I knew he was scared. We all get scared trying something new and even worse is the fear of failing while someone we don't know is watching. Well I walked up to him and introduced myself and said "why don't you come see the range. You can shoot one arrow and if you don't like it, you won't ever have to do it again."

He agreed. An hour later his whole face was lit up with excitement. He became confident and the next day when he came into the archery shop he left his mom out in the parking lot and excitedly said, "Miss Beth! I'm here for my lesson!" He was a wild child born with the bow in his hand.

The transformation was immediate and it stayed with him. This is when I knew this was what I was meant to do with my life. Show people what they are capable of, reaching their full potential not only in archery but in life. Archery will teach you more about yourself than you can imagine.

Be Brave, Be a Wild Child.
